The Scoundrel tree is one of the most tempting to use in Divinity: Original Sin 2. Scoundrels focus on hiding in the shadows. They sneak across the battlefield undetected and assault their enemies with lethal backstabs. Some players may have always been interested in what a Scoundrel can do and some players may be new to the game.

The Scoundrel tree is filled with deadly abilities that can bring enemies to their knees. The most important part of using this tree is to focus on getting backstabs and moving far across the battlefield.

10 Backlash

backlash launches the player behind the enemy and backstabs them in divinity 2

Backlash is one of the most essential skills for any Scoundrel build.  It can be chosen when creating a new character or when the player reaches Fort Joy. This skill teleports the player who uses it behind the enemy and backstabs them at the same time. One of the best parts about this perk is the low action point cost. This skill only costs one action point. The downside is that it has a 3 turn cooldown, so players will have to rely on other means to get behind other enemies. That's where the other skills come in.

9 Cloak And Dagger

Cloak and dagger allows players to jump to new locations in divinity 2

Cloak and Dagger is another skill that can be retrieved pretty early in the game. To get this skill, players will need to wait until they reach level four. After reaching level four, players will be able to buy this skill from Hilde in Fort Joy. The Cloak and Dagger skill allows the player to teleport a far distance. The most important part about this skill is that it doesn't break a player's stealth or invisibility. This skill is great to use when sneaking around enemies or trying to break into areas outside of battle.

8 Chloroform

Chloroform causes damage to enemy magic armor and can cause sleep in divinity 2

The Scoundrel tree has some great abilities that can be retrieved early in the game. Chloroform is another one of these great abilities that can be retrieved as soon as a player reaches Fort Joy. Chloroform is extremely useful for a Scoundrel player to have throughout the game. It deals direct damage to an enemy's magic armor. If the enemy doesn't have any magic armor left, Chloroform puts them to sleep. The sleeping status effect only lasts for one turn, but it is useful if a player is in a bind.

7 Throwing Knife

Throwing knives are great for distance attacks that can also backstab in divinity 2

One of the greatest things about running the Scoundrel tree is that every attack skill can backstab. The Throwing Knife skill is one of the many skills capable of backstabbing an enemy despite it being able to be used from a distance. Scoundrel players tend to not run out of movement easily, but in the case that they do, this skill has a good distance and costs two action points.

This is yet another skill that can be bought early in the game. Traditionally, this skill costs three hundred gold from Hilde in Fort Joy, but players can always get it for less if they have points in their bartering.

6 Rupture Tendons

rupture tendons causes enemies to bleed and get damaged whenever they move in divinity 2

Rupture Tendons is a great skill for players to obtain as soon as they can. It is a great skill to use against boss enemies to take them down a peg. This skill is great for two reasons. One, it deals one hundred percent damage to the enemy and can backstab. Two, it causes the enemy to take damage whenever they decide to move. Setting up a situation where the enemy will have to move after using this skill will cause them to receive piercing damage with each step. Ruptured Tendons only lasts for two turns, but it is worth it.

5 Sawtooth Knife

sawtooth knife hits the enemies health directly in divinity 2

Even better than Rupture Tendons is the Sawtooth Knife skill. This skill can be grabbed after a player reaches level four from Hilde in Fort Joy. What makes this skill great is that it deals direct damage to the enemy's health bar without needing to go through physical armor. If the enemy happens to not have physical armor, this skill causes them to bleed for three turns. Like many of the other skills, this one can backstab.

4 Gag Order

gag order hurts enemy magic armor and causes silence in divinity 2

Like Chloroform, the Gag Order skill is useful against enemies with magic armor. This skill destroys the enemy's magic armor and also sets the silenced status effect for one turn. Silenced is great to use against enemies that use magic. It removed their capability to use any magical abilities and forces them to attack with physical attacks. This skill can be obtained randomly, but players can also purchase the skill from Papa Thrash in the Driftwood Tavern.

3 Sleeping Arms

Sleeping arms gives enemies atrophy in divinity 2

Sleeping Arms is a perfect skill to use against enemies that use a lot of physical attacks. This skill deals one hundred percent damage, can backstab, and also applies the atrophy status effect.

The atrophy status effect makes the enemy rely on magical ability because it takes away their ability to use their weapon and any physical attack abilities. Atrophy is set for two turns. This skill is another that can be bought from Papa Thrash in Driftwood.

2 Fan Of Knives

fan of knives hits all enemies within range with throwing knives in divinity 2

Fan of Knives is one of the source abilities that Scoundrel players get access to and possibly the best of them. Like many other skills, Fan of Knives can backstab, but the best thing about it is that it can backstab multiple enemies at once. This skill flings a throwing knife at each target within the area of effect. Each of these knives deals one hundred and twenty-five percent damage to the enemy they hit. This skill is perfect when caught in a situation where there are a lot of enemies. It is also another skill that can be bought in act two from Papa Thrash in Driftwood.

1 Terrifying Cruelty

terrifying cruelty hurts enemies and terrifies them in divinity 2

Possibly the best skill to use on a single enemy from the Scoundrel tree is Terrifying Cruelty. This skill can inflict two different status effects on the enemy hit by it, Terrified and Bleeding. Bleeding will cause damage over time for two turns and Terrified will cause the enemy to run away in fear. On top of that, this skill deals one hundred and ten percent damage to the enemy and can backstab. The only downside to this skill is that it costs three action points to use and has a four turn cooldown.
